Pool

Pool is a historic hundred in the county of Montgomery. It was number 3 out of 9 (in population) in the county of Montgomery and number 43 out of 90 in all of Wales.

Family Occupations

This pie chart shows the principle occupation by family in Pool. For Pool, the proportion of families that were mainly involved in Agriculture was 48.94%. In Manufacture and Trade, the proportion was 34.77%, and other occupations made up 16.29%.

For comparison, for the entire county of Montgomery the proportion of families that were mainly involved in Agriculture was 49.3%. In Manufacture and Trade, the proportion was 31.31%, and other occupations made up 19.39%.

For comparison, for the entire country of Wales (including the county of Monmouth), the proportion of families that was mainly involved in Agriculture were 42.27%. In Manufacture and Trade, the proportion was 28.6%, and other occupations made up 29.13%.

Male Occupations

The bar chart shows a breakdown in occupations of males over 20 in the hundred of Pool. The following is a proportion breakdown of each employment type (with comparisons to county and country levels):

Occupation Pool Montgomery Wales
Agriculture Employing Labourers 8.39% 11.59% 9.65%
Agriculture Not Employing Labourers 4.71% 9.63% 9.53%
Agriculture that are Labourers 35.28%34.37% 27.22%
Manufacturing 3.1% 9.8% 4.29%
Retail Trade or Handicraft 26.62%20.15% 22.51%
Professional or other Education Occupation4.08% 2.5% 2.71%
Labourers not in Agriculture 11.62%5.84% 17.48%
Servants 1.48% 1.02% 1.12%
Other Occupations 4.71% 5.11% 5.5%

Housing

This pie chart shows the houses in Pool by completion and whether they were inhabited. For Pool, the proportion of houses that were inhabited was 97.94%. For houses being built, the proportion was 0.4%, and uninhabited made up 1.66%.

For comparison, for the entire county of Montgomery, the proportion of houses that were inhabited was 96.33%. For houses being built, the proportion was 0.49%, and uninhabited made up 3.18%.

For comparison, for the entire country of Wales (including the county of Monmouth), the proportion of houses that were inhabited was 95.35%. For houses being built, the proportion was 0.8%, and uninhabited made up 3.84%.
